A cb is inexpensive and will help you out more than most other things people often get first when they get their jeep. So provided you have a first aid kit, and recovery gear the next thing should be a cb. I've been in situations where the person in front of me was taking a bad angle and making it worst by trying to correct and could have rolled it...through the cb I was able to tell him to stop and I got out and spotted him. Get the cb...my first one was less than $25 on Amazon.
